Output 6ef5a108172446c517e7f4935e4d2b0a00e025de958de1599525176aae8d5479:1

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ff1fe0a86b5af1d80c93615d2826428a9a7c05 OP_EQUAL
address
39XizDF13own6to7BvvwdbC4XjVCGkQ5ah
transaction
6ef5a108172446c517e7f4935e4d2b0a00e025de958de1599525176aae8d5479
confirmations
63070
spent
true